What Is Dark Web Search

Dark web search refers to using specialized search engines to locate content hosted on Tor hidden services. Unlike Google or Bing, these engines index only .onion addresses and sites designed for anonymity. They operate on the same principle as surface search engines but work within the constraints of Tor's network architecture. Most dark web search engines are themselves hosted as hidden services, meaning you access them through Tor Browser. They crawl publicly available .onion directories and index pages that haven't been blocked or removed. The results you get depend on what the search engine has indexed, which is typically a fraction of all hidden content. Many .onion sites deliberately avoid indexing to maintain privacy or security.

How Dark Web Search Engines Work

Dark web search engines operate by deploying crawlers that follow links across .onion sites and catalog their content. The process mirrors surface web indexing but faces unique challenges. Tor's network architecture means crawlers move slowly and cannot access sites behind authentication walls or those that block automated requests. Search engines must balance comprehensiveness with resource constraints—crawling the entire dark web would consume enormous bandwidth and processing power. Most dark web search engines use keyword matching and relevance ranking similar to traditional search, though their algorithms are typically simpler due to the smaller index size. Results are usually less refined than surface web searches because the index is smaller and less frequently updated. Some engines prioritize recent content, while others maintain static indexes updated periodically. The quality and freshness of results vary significantly between different dark web search platforms.

Comparing Dark Web Search vs. Surface Web Search

Dark web search engines operate under different constraints than surface web search. Surface search engines index billions of pages and use sophisticated ranking algorithms refined over decades. Dark web search engines index thousands or tens of thousands of pages and use simpler ranking methods. Surface search results are typically more relevant and comprehensive because the index is vastly larger. Dark web search results often include outdated or dead links because maintenance is inconsistent. Surface web search is faster because the infrastructure is centralized and optimized. Dark web search is slower due to Tor's network latency. Surface search results can be personalized based on your location and history; dark web search engines typically don't track users. Dark web search is better for finding niche content, hidden forums, and privacy-focused resources. Surface search is better for general information, news, and mainstream content. Neither is inherently superior; they serve different purposes and audiences.

Can I use regular search engines on the dark web?

No. Google, Bing, and other surface search engines cannot access .onion sites because they're not indexed by conventional crawlers. You must use specialized dark web search engines that are themselves hosted on Tor. These engines crawl only hidden services and index their content separately from the surface web.

Is dark web search illegal?

Searching the dark web itself is not illegal in most jurisdictions. However, searching for illegal content, services, or goods is illegal. The legality depends on what you search for and your location. Using Tor and dark web search engines for legitimate purposes—research, privacy, accessing information in censored regions—is legal.

How much of the dark web can search engines index?

Dark web search engines index only a small fraction of all hidden content. Many .onion sites deliberately avoid indexing, use authentication, or block crawlers. Estimates suggest indexed content represents less than 5% of all hidden services. Most dark web content is discoverable only through direct links, community forums, or word-of-mouth.
